Output 621aeb9c88a30c5ab7c2f44cd99e43f906cdff22cfe2e052fedf847ba303382a:0

value
159588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828478808425a077c4c22c4e3adde8eedda41a44 OP_EQUAL
address
MKoGmbSAVu6kauKWkoL32ph6nAshczAP49
transaction
621aeb9c88a30c5ab7c2f44cd99e43f906cdff22cfe2e052fedf847ba303382a
spent
true